MscmpSystSettings (mscmp_syst_settings v0.1.0)
A user options configuration management service.
The Settings Service provides caching and management functions for user configurable options which govern how the application operates. Multiple Settings Service instances may be in operation depending on the needs of the application; for example, in the case of multi-tenancy, each tenant will have its own instance of the Setting Service running since each tenant's needs of the application may unique.
On startup, the Settings Service creates an in memory cache and populates the cache from the database. Inquiries for settings are then served from the cache rather than the database as needed. Operations which change the Settings data are written to the database and then updated in the cache.
Settings maintained by this service may be changed by users at any time while the application is running. Therefore, any logic depending on the Settings from this service should be written as to be insensitive to such changes. Logic should avoid multiple retrievals of the same setting during any one transaction.

Settings
create_setting(creation_params)
@spec create_setting(MscmpSystSettings.Types.setting_params()) :: :ok | {:error, MscmpSystError.t()}
Creates a new user defined setting.
This function creates a setting which is automatically marked as being user
defined. User created settings such as those created by this function are the
only kind of settings which may be deleted via delete_setting/2
.
Parameters
creation_params
a map defining the new settings record. The map must contain the following keys:internal_name
- This is the unique value which represents the name of the setting and is used for latter lookup of setting values. This key should be suitable for programmatic references to the setting.display_name
- A unique value used to display the setting name in user interface contexts.user_description
- A user visible description of the setting including information describing how the setting is used in the application and directions for correct usage. Currently, the description must be at least 6 characters long.
other allowed values, such as the setting values themselves, are also permitted here, but not required.
Examples
iex> new_setting = %{
...> internal_name: "create_example_setting",
...> display_name: "Create Example Setting",
...> user_description: "An example of setting creation.",
...> setting_integer: 9876
...> }
iex> MscmpSystSettings.create_setting(new_setting)
:ok

put_settings_service(service_name)
@spec put_settings_service(MscmpSystSettings.Types.service_name() | nil) :: MscmpSystSettings.Types.service_name() | nil
Establishes the current Settings Service instance for the process.
A running system is likely to have more than one instance of the Settings Service running. For example, in multi-tenant applications each tenant may have its own instance of the Setting Service, caching data unique to the tenant.
Calling MscmpSystSettings.put_settings_service/1
will set the reference to
the desired Settings Service instance for any subsequent MscmpSystSettings
calls. The service name is set in the Process Dictionary of the process from
which the calls are being made. As such, you must call put_settings_service
at least once for any process from which you wish to access the Settings
Service.
Because we're just thinly wrapping Process.put/2
here, the return value will
be the previous value set here, or nil if no previous value was set.
Parameters
service_name
- The name of the service which is to be set as servicing the process.
Examples
iex> MscmpSystSettings.put_settings_service(:settings_test_service)

start_link(params)
@spec start_link( {MscmpSystSettings.Types.service_name(), MscmpSystDb.Types.context_name()} ) :: {:ok, pid()} | {:error, MscmpSystError.t()}
Starts an instance of the Settings Service.
Starting the service establishes the required processes and pre-populates the service cache with data from the database. Most other functions in this module require that the service is started prior to use and will fail if the service is not started.
The service_name
argument provides a unique name under which the service can
be found. This argument is a subset of those that allowed for registering
GenServers; the allowed forms for service name are simple atoms for basic
local name registry or a "via tuple", such as might be used with the
Registry
module.
The datastore_context_name
is an atom which represents a started
MscmpSystDb
context. This context will be used for accessing and
modifying database data.
